Economie Du Bien Commun by Jean Tirole
A wide-ranging reflection on how economic analysis can be mobilized to serve the common good, it sets out principles for regulating markets, promoting competition, and designing institutions in the presence of information asymmetries; it addresses contemporary challenges such as climate change, digital platforms, financial stability, and labor market disruptions, and advocates pragmatic, evidence-based policies that balance incentives, innovation, and social protection while enhancing democratic legitimacy and transparency so that markets and the state complement each other in pursuit of shared prosperity.
